npower adds Warriors weight to Inclusive Rugby

Thanks to significant additional resources this season from our principle community partner npower, the Warriors community team have been at the very forefront of the provision for disabled athletes.

The inclusive rugby scheme of work is joint funded by the English Federation for Disability Sport, the RFU and npower. The funding allows the growing Warriors Community team to run a substantial inclusive rugby programme, as demonstrated at half time of the Warriors versus Ospreys fixture at Sixways Stadium in October. 

The most recent work has been carried out by Simon Lane and Steve Joslin, Warriors Community Rugby Coaches, as they performed a key role in identifying talented disabled athletes and looked at ways to support these young people to ensure they fulfil their potential and be the best they can be in their chosen sport- some even as far (we hope!) as London 2012.

“Some sports are not yet fully on board in regard to inclusive sports. However, rugby, through Worcester Warriors, have been fantastic in their commitment to this project, with both Warriors coaches being very professional in their coaching and attitude on the day,” commented Vicky Webley, Senior Competition Manager and Co-ordinator of the Talent Camp.
